The Real Costs of Cabbage Farming in Burundi
Every Cabbage farming season begins with costs before a single income arrives. This is the reality of farming and it is not something to be afraid of. But it is something every farmer needs to understand clearly so that when the harvest comes, you know exactly how much you need to cover before you start making profit.
Here is what a typical Cabbage farming season in Burundi involves in terms of spending. Every cost depends on your own situation, your land and your methods.
| 1 | Seedlings, whether raised in a nursery or purchased from a local supplier | Investing in healthy seedlings is crucial for a bountiful harvest. Some farmers opt to cultivate their own seedlings from selected strong plants, which can lower costs, while others choose to buy ready-made seedlings to ensure a uniform start. Your choice can significantly influence the vigor and success of your cabbage crop. |
| 2 | Fertilizer, whether organic from compost or chemical supplements | Applying the right fertilizer can dramatically impact your cabbage's growth and yield. Some farmers prefer organic inputs derived from their own farms, which can enrich soil health over time. Others may invest in commercial fertilizers, providing quicker nutrient availability but requiring careful management. |
| 3 | Water supply, whether from irrigation systems or rainwater collection | Consistent moisture is vital for cabbage, especially during dry spells. Many farmers choose to implement irrigation systems, while others rely on natural rainfall and collect rainwater during the rainy season. Balancing water needs with available resources is key to healthy growth. |
| 4 | Labor, whether hired workers or family help | The labor intensity of cabbage farming can vary depending on the farm's size and available support. Some farmers enlist family members, creating a cooperative spirit, while others may hire local help for specific tasks. Thoughtful management of labor resources can enhance productivity and foster community ties. |
| 5 | Pest control, whether through traditional methods or modern pesticides | Managing pests is an essential part of cabbage farming, requiring a careful approach. Some farmers use traditional methods such as companion planting and natural repellents, while others might utilize chemical options for immediate results. Choosing a pest control strategy that aligns with both environmental sustainability and crop health is crucial. |
| 6 | Transportation, whether using a bicycle or hired transport | Getting cabbage to market is a vital step, with farmers often deciding between personal transport methods or hiring local transport services. Reliable transportation can significantly affect the freshness and quality of produce upon reaching buyers, which in turn influences sales. |
| 7 | Market fees, whether paid at local markets or to wholesalers | Engaging with the market may come with various fees that influence overall profits. Farmers selling directly at local markets face different structures compared to those supplying wholesalers. Understanding these costs can help farmers better calculate their profit margins. |
| 8 | Insurance, whether through cooperative programs or personal efforts | Insurance can provide peace of mind, especially in uncertain markets. Some farmers join cooperative initiatives to obtain affordable coverage, while others may individually seek different options. The right insurance can safeguard your investment against unexpected losses. |

That break-even figure is the one that surprises most farmers the most. Many smallholder farmers sell their harvest without this number and as a result find themselves negotiating without a clear bottom line. Once you know your break-even point you know the minimum price you can accept and the minimum quantity you need to sell. That knowledge alone changes everything about how you approach the market.

Practical Tips for Cabbage Farmers in Burundi
1. Use crop rotation to improve soil health: Rotating cabbage with other crops can rejuvenate your soil, preventing nutrient depletion. Farmers who rotate effectively enjoy healthier plants and increased yields, while those who don't may see declining harvests over time. This practice not only benefits cabbage but enhances the whole farm ecosystem.
2. Apply organic fertilizers for better long-term gains: Incorporating well-decomposed organic matter can boost your soil's nutrient capacity. Farmers who invest time in developing compost and using organic inputs often witness improved soil fertility and crop resilience. In contrast, relying solely on chemical fertilizers can lead to short-term crops without addressing long-term soil health.
3. Schedule planting according to weather forecasts: Monitoring climatic patterns helps ensure optimal growth conditions for your cabbage. Farmers who align planting times with seasonal rains will often realize healthier crops, while those who plant at the wrong time may face drought stress. Staying informed enhances your chances of a successful harvest.
4. Record your expenses meticulously: Keeping track of every expense related to your cabbage farming can reveal patterns and areas for improvement. Many successful farmers use detailed records to analyze which practices yield the best returns, while those who neglect this often miss opportunities to cut costs. The right accounting can lead to substantial savings.
5. Explore community markets for better prices: Engaging with local community markets can often enhance your sales prices while fostering connections. Farmers who sell directly to consumers frequently enjoy better pricing than those who rely solely on wholesalers. Building these connections can ensure your cabbage finds the best market.

4. What common pests should I watch for in cabbage farming?
Cabbage farmers must be vigilant about pests such as aphids, cabbage worms, and snails. These pests can severely affect your crop yield if not managed properly. Employing integrated pest management techniques can help maintain a healthier crop.
